Given our harsh winters and road salt from Route 2 and the Islands Line, corrosion of brake lines, exhaust systems, and suspension components is a major concern. For Nissans, particularly older models, this can accelerate issues with CVT transmissions under heavy load from snow and ice, making regular fluid checks vital.
You should seek immediate service if you notice hesitation, jerking, or whining noises during acceleration, especially after driving on hilly terrain or in deep snow common in Grand Isle County. Regular CVT fluid service every 60,000 miles is critical here, as stop-and-go summer tourist traffic and severe winter conditions put extra strain on the transmission.
